What Are You Feeding Your Spirit?
If you eat junk food— salty snacks and savory sweets, fast food, and the only fruit you consume is in ‘snack’ form your body is going to run horribly. You won’t have as much energy, your digestive track will be out of whack, and your organs will start shutting down as they scream for nutrients...you know the “good stuff”. Our spirit works the same way. What we feed it will either strengthen us & give us the “good stuff” we need or it will deprive us and starve us. What are you consuming? Social media 24/7? Rap music that glorifies satisfying the flesh? Movies and videos that cause your mind and heart to stray from God? Or are you filling yourself up on the daily Bread of Life— Jesus? Are you being satisfied by His word? Reflect on what you consume the most & think about how it’s affecting your day-to-day thoughts, words, actions, and reactions.
